He has had two more procedures done on his knee since last Wednesday. I heard there is a "possibility" he will not play next year, or even the year after if they do have to do a complete replacement. Right now it "seems" as if it is preventative medicine, but it just might be really bad for him. I never liked him, in the football sense, which by my twisted logic means I really liked him, because the guy is an opponent. I hope his infection clears and we see him next year. The game isn't the same without him.

ESPN is reporting a RUMOR? Is this the same site that sent emails to employees to NOT mention ANYTHING about BretT?

http://sports.espn.go.com/nfl/news/story?id=3658987 

The Patriots, sources told ESPN early Thursday, are upset because they wanted Brady's surgery done under the direction of doctors of their choosing in Boston.

The Patriots later denied that report in a statement: "Today, ESPN cited an unnamed source who supposedly expressed the feelings of the Patriots 'organization.' This unsubstantiated report does not represent the team's views whatsoever. We have supported Tom Brady one hundred percent from day one of this process and will continue to do so."
